XO-543
Vishay Dale
Full Size Clock Oscillators TTL/HCMOS Compatible
The XO-543 series is with 3.3 V power supply. The metal
package with pin #7 case ground acts as shielding to
minimize EMI radiation.
FEATURES
• 14 pin full size
• Industry standard
• Wide frequency range
RoHS
• Low cost
COMPLIANT
• Tri-State enable/disable
• Resistance weld package
• 3.3 V
• Lead (Pb)-free terminations and RoHS compliant

Pin 1, Tri-State Function
Pin 1 = H or open.... Output active at pin 8
Pin 1 = L.... High Impedance at pin 8
* Include: 25 ºC tolerance, operating temperature range, input voltage change, aging, load change, shock and vibration.
